The Green Building Council of Australia will lead a tour of Sydney’s 39 Hunter Street. This was the first heritage building in Australia to achieve a 6 Star rating, following extensive refurbishment works of the historic former Perpetual Trustees Building.

Sustainability and rich architectural heritage have been expertly integrated throughout the transformation with existing features retained, including vaulted ceilings and decorative columns and beams. Innovative sustainable upgrades complement the restored architecture, to ensure optimal building performance and occupant comfort, in addition to classic aesthetic appeal.
